Economy

The economy of Attapulgus, GA employs 350 people. The largest industries in Attapulgus, GA are Information (104 people), Construction (48 people), and Manufacturing (32 people), and the highest paying industries are N/A.

Median Earnings by Industry

$20,580
Median earning men ± $14,450
$21,549
Median earning women ± $18,806

The industries with the best median earnings for men in 2023 are Manufacturing ($53,281), Professional, Scientific, & Management, & Administrative & Waste Management Services ($46,250), and Agriculture, Forestry, Fishing & Hunting, & Mining ($40,500).

The industries with the best median earnings for women in 2023 are Public Administration ($43,125), Manufacturing ($36,563), and Educational Services, & Health Care & Social Assistance ($11,563).

Wage Distribution

The closest comparable wage GINI for Attapulgus, GA is from Georgia.
0.474
2022 Wage GINI in Georgia
0.475
2021 Wage GINI in Georgia

In 2022, the income inequality in Georgia was 0.474 according to the GINI calculation of the wage distribution. Income inequality had a 0.224% decline from 2021 to 2022, which means that wage distribution grew somewhat more even. The GINI for Georgia was lower than than the national average of 0.478. In other words, wages are distributed more evenly in Georgia in comparison to the national average.

Commuter Transportation

Most Common Commute in 2023
  1. Drove Alone (92%)
  2. Carpooled (6.57%)
  3. Other (1.43%)

In 2023, 92% of workers in Attapulgus, GA drove alone to work, followed by those who carpooled to work (6.57%) and those who used some unspecified means to get work (1.43%).

Commute Time

47.1 minutes
Average Travel Time

Using averages, employees in Attapulgus, GA have a longer commute time (47.1 minutes) than the normal US worker (26.6 minutes). Additionally, 18.9% of the workforce in Attapulgus, GA have "super commutes" in excess of 90 minutes.

Poverty & Diversity

54% of the population for whom poverty status is determined in Attapulgus, GA (400 out of 741 people) live below the poverty line, a number that is higher than the national average of 12.4%. The largest demographic living in poverty are N/A N/A, followed by N/A N/A and then N/A N/A.

The most common racial or ethnic group living below the poverty line in Attapulgus, GA is Hispanic, followed by Other and White.

The Census Bureau uses a set of money income thresholds that vary by family size and composition to determine who classifies as impoverished. If a family's total income is less than the family's threshold than that family and every individual in it is considered to be living in poverty.

Health

78.4% of the population of Attapulgus, GA has health coverage, with 28.5% on employee plans, 42.1% on Medicaid, 4.3% on Medicare, 3.36% on non-group plans, and 0.134% on military or VA plans.
